想要实现的功能:点击按钮,在光标停留的地方,插入一段文案: 实现效果-插入文案为'{test}'.png <el-input@blur="testBlur"v-model="form.couponName"></el-input><el-button@click="test">点击</el-button>// datablurIndex:null// 光标位置// methodtestBlur(e){this.blurIndex=e.srcElement.selectionSta...
el-input是Element UI框架中的一个输入框组件,光标位置指的是在输入框中文本插入点的位置。 查找el-input组件的DOM元素: 由于el-input是一个Vue组件,我们需要先获取其对应的DOM元素。这通常可以通过Vue的ref属性或者查询DOM来实现。 编写代码以获取el-input组件的实例: 使用Vue的ref属性可以方便地获取组件实例,然后...
直接上代码: <scriptsetup>import {ref,nextTick } from'vue'let inputValue=ref(null) let inputRef=ref(null) const handleInput=()=>{//获取光标位置const cursorPosition=inputRef.value.input.selectionStart;//转大写并去掉空格inputValue.value=inputValue.value.toUpperCase().replace(/\s+/g,"");//...
this.$refs.input.$el.querySelector('input').focus() }) 因为有的时候input中是有默认值的,自动获取焦点谷歌和火狐、360浏览器光标都正常。但是在IE上光标就跑到默认值的最左边去了,、 查了下好像IE浏览器下input的光标默认就是在最左边的,很显然这不符合我们的需求,每次输入的时候用户还要多点一次。 我们...
在IE浏览器中,当input获得焦点时,点击有unselectable="on"属性的标签时,不会触发onblur事件。 unselectable设置可选择性状态的字符串。 可能值: off:默认值,选择过程可以从元素的内容开始。 on:无法在元素的内容中启动选择过程。 这种情况主要是解决IE浏览器中的光标出现问题。火狐浏览器中不支持。
<!-- 访客可预约时间期限 --><el-inputtype="number"class="orderBox"placeholder="请输入1~30的整数"style="width: 200px;margin-right: 14px;"v-model="orderDay":min="1":max="30"></el-input>天 <styletype="text/css"scoped>/deep/.orderBox .el-input__inner { ...
Input组件是否支持设置文本居中对齐 如何获取窗口的宽高信息 通用属性width是否支持设置变量 如何判断JS对象中是否存在某个值 应用如何设置隐藏顶部的状态栏 如何锁定设备竖屏,使得窗口不随屏幕旋转 调用window实例的setWindowSystemBarProperties接口设置窗口状态栏和导航栏的高亮属性时不生效 如何保持屏幕常亮 ...
VUE+ElementUI,遇到个问题:el-input输入框,输入内容后,键盘左右键不能控制光标左右移动。 代码类似如下: <el-form class="clearfix" :model="qm" label-width="70px"> <el-row :gutter="10"> <el-col :span="22"> <el-row :gutter="10"> <el-col :md="5"> <el-form-item label="设备编码...
前言今天在写代码时,一时觉得代码里面有一些图标,光标移到那里代码又显示处理了,这样会使那行代码忽长忽短,看起来很变扭,着实难受。...早就看到了,但是不知道这个是啥原因导致的,然后就百度了一度,本以为是插件的原因,结果发现是vscode配置导致,下面情况问题及解
和图片上传相同,不同的是上传文件。解决的思路也相同:在vue-quill-editor中自定义按钮,点击使用iView的文件上传,然后将地址赋值给a标签的href属性,插入到富文本光标处。 步骤 一、自定义编辑器附件上传 我想通过download属性自定义文件下载名称,但是两种方式都失败了,可以忽略相关代码。以下是为富文本自定义插入a链接...